Types of Electric Ovens for Bakery

There are several different types of electric ovens that are commonly used in bakeries. Each type has its own set of features and benefits, so it’s important to understand the differences between them before making a purchase. Here are some of the most common types of electric ovens used in bakery applications:

1. Deck ovens: Deck ovens are one of the most popular types of ovens used in bakeries. These ovens have multiple shelves, or “decks,” that can be loaded with trays of baked goods. Deck ovens are known for their even heat distribution and the ability to bake multiple items at once.

2. Convection ovens: Convection ovens use fans to circulate hot air around the oven, which helps to cook food more quickly and evenly. These ovens are great for baking pastries, cookies, and other delicate baked goods.

3. Rotary ovens: Rotary ovens have a rotating rack that moves the trays of baked goods around the oven, ensuring that they are evenly baked on all sides. These ovens are ideal for baking bread and other dense, hearty baked goods.

4. Combination ovens: Combination ovens offer the benefits of both convection and steam cooking in one unit. These ovens are versatile and can be used for a wide range of baking applications.

Tips for Choosing the Right Electric Oven for Bakery

When selecting an electric oven for your bakery, there are several factors to consider to ensure that you are getting the best oven for your needs. Here are some tips for choosing the right electric oven for bakery applications:

1. Size: Consider the size of your bakery operation and the volume of baked goods that you need to produce. Make sure to choose an oven that is large enough to accommodate your production needs.

2. Energy efficiency: Look for an electric oven that is energy efficient to help save on operating costs. Consider ovens with features like insulation, programmable settings, and energy-saving modes.

3. Temperature control: Ensure that the oven you choose has precise temperature control to achieve consistent baking results. Look for ovens with digital controls and multiple cooking modes.

4. Durability: Invest in a high-quality oven that is built to last. Look for ovens made from stainless steel or other durable materials that can withstand heavy use in a bakery environment.

5. Ventilation: Proper ventilation is essential for maintaining air circulation in the oven and preventing moisture buildup. Make sure that the oven you choose has adequate ventilation to ensure even baking.

6. Brand reputation: Research different oven brands and read reviews from other bakery owners to find a reputable and reliable brand. Look for ovens with a good warranty and customer support.
